Я установил Wireguard со следующими командами:
судо подходящее обновление
sudo apt установить wireguard
Затем я установил resolvconf
:
sudo apt установить resolvconf
Созданные ключи:
умаск 077
РГ Генкей | sudo тройник /etc/wireguard/private.key
sudo cat /etc/wireguard/private.key | общедоступный ключ | sudo тройник /etc/wireguard/public.key
Наконец, создал конфиг:
судо нано /etc/wireguard/wg0.conf
# ниже содержимое конфигурационного файла
[Интерфейс]
Приватный ключ = опущен
Адрес = 10.9.0.7/32
DNS = 1.0.0.1
[Вглядеться]
Публичный ключ = опущен
Разрешенные IP-адреса = 0.0.0.0/0, ::/0
Конечная точка = 95.87.101.10:51820
После выполнения sudo wg-быстрый wg0
все мои приложения остались без интернета.
Интернет возвращается после того, как я sudo wg-быстро вниз wg0
Wireguard.
У меня нет доступа к серверу, он обслуживается компанией.
Я могу вмешиваться только в свою собственную машину.
Я не разбираюсь в сети, моя компания сказала, что просто следуйте приведенным выше инструкциям, и все будет работать, но вот что я пытался решить проблему:
Я пробовал предложения от этот вопрос но без успеха.
судо ВГ
дал следующий вывод:
интерфейс: WG0
открытый ключ: y5ZpnepnWHWBOvm04iDUh/+XgLIZKSOClI4It5D/ESU=
закрытый ключ: (скрытый)
порт прослушивания: 43460
отметка: 0xca6c
коллега: KIkiNWfiSEGYbXAGvNau8kOlG8rqFFEFeNzPjnUzz0Q=
конечная точка: 95.87.101.10:51820
разрешенные ips: 0.0.0.0/0, ::/0
передача: 0 B получено, 296 B отправлено
Я предположил, что рукопожатие работает, но что-то еще мешает интернет-соединению.
IP-маршрут показать
дал мне это:
по умолчанию через 192.168.1.1 dev wlx3c7c3f49907c proto dhcp metric 600
169.254.0.0/16 dev wlx3c7c3f49907c метрика ссылки области 1000
192.168.1.0/24 dev wlx3c7c3f49907c ссылка на область действия ядра src 192.168.1.7 метрика 600
Погуглив, я пришел к выводу, что DHCP-винты маршрутизируют по умолчанию, но я не знаю, как это исправить. я пытался sudo ip route добавить по умолчанию через 192.168.1.1
но и это не помогло. IP-маршрут
при включенном Wireguard выдает следующий вывод:
по умолчанию через 192.168.1.1 dev wlx3c7c3f49907c
по умолчанию через 192.168.1.1 dev wlx3c7c3f49907c proto dhcp metric 600
169.254.0.0/16 dev wlx3c7c3f49907c метрика ссылки области 1000
192.168.1.0/24 dev wlx3c7c3f49907c ссылка на область действия ядра src 192.168.1.6 метрика 600
я пытался sudo cat /proc/sys/net/ipv4/ip_forward
но и это не помогло.
Это лучшее, что я могу сделать, так как я не очень разбираюсь в сетях. Я наткнулся на этот сайт после поиска в Google, поэтому решил обратиться за помощью в отчаянной надежде, что решение будет найдено.
Если вам нужна дополнительная информация, оставьте комментарий, и я отвечу.